AceShowbiz - Tori Spelling and her family only wanted to share their fun time during Halloween week, but a comment of a troll on Instagram seemingly ruined the moment. The "BH90210" star treated her online followers to a family photo of their "yearly tradition," but one fan focused more on the hair color of Tori's daughter Hattie.

The photos, which was posted on Sunday, October 27, the TV star, husband Dean McDermott and their kids were having a family trip to a pumpkin patch for Halloween. "Our yearly tradition... a family outing to the local pumpkin patch," so the actress wrote in the caption. "Loved the pumpkins, bouncy castle, slides, and family fun!"

Most people in the comment section left good and gushing comments about how adorable the family looked. "our children are wonderful what great parents they have!" one person wrote. Another fan added, "How fun. such a wonderful tradition beautiful family."

one person appeared to be bothered by Hattie's new hair color. The eight-year-old stood out as she sported cherry cola-hued hair.

"Why would you let your daughter have red hair? Parenting gone wrong," the person criticized. When others tried to push back against the criticism, the user hit back, "I would NEVER dye my kids' hair at all at a young age. When they get older and CAN make their OWN decisions then they can do whatever they want."

"A child that young shouldn't have their hair colored at all," she continued. "They should embrace their beauty and naturalness. I don't think that child should have her hair like that. She should embrace her natural beauty."

While Tori has yet to respond to the criticism, her fans continued to jump to her defense. One of the 46-year-old's defenders called the hater a "busy body."
